CHANDIGARH, January 15: Remote sensing conducted by the Punjab Remote Sensing Centre in Talwandi Sabo in Bathinda district seeks to affirm that the plains in the area have been formed from alluvial deposits. Satellite imagery indicates that the area was traversed by some river which may be Sutlej, as historic evidence says. The evidence for this assumption is also indicated by palaeochannels, as represented by sand dunes in the area.

The report was prepared by the Centre for "Integrated Mission for Sustainable Development". It has recommended that the consumptive use of brackish water from tubewells should be encouraged and that underground water needs to be pumped by installing shallow tubewells even in brackish water zone. The study warns that failure to do so would lead to water-logging problems in the area.

It also recommends that the Lissara Nallah, which drains the area along the northern boundary of Talwandi Sabo, needs to be provided an outlet into river Ghaggar. The Talwandi Sabo tehsil does not have any river flowing through its area.

The project was prepared under the supervision of P.K. Sharma and M.L. Manchanda, and included V.K. Verma and Anil Sood of the Punjab Remote Sensing Centre.

The report adds that the underground water in most of the area is brackish. The area lacks proper drainage network as there is only one major drain (Lissara Nallah) in the area which cannot drain out the excess water during rainy season. The study has recommended in situ stabilisation of high sand dunes by planting species like Sarkanda, Ber, Pahari Kikar, Kikar, and Sababul among others. Reclamation of salt affected and the waterlogged area has been suggested apart from bringing them under plantation.The release of additional canal water during the months of April and May and the supply of water should be reduced during the months of June to September, it adds. This would result in reducing the insect and pest attack on cotton crop.
